WebbCuban Santeria Practices. Santeria is a fusion of Catholic practices and African folk beliefs. It emerged in Cuba during the 17th century, and has been embedded in Cuban society ever since. This artisan carves the statue by hand of seasoned African sese … Webb1 juni 2016 · The Shango Priestess Wifredo Lam was born in 1902, the year of Cuba's independence, to a Chinese father and a mulatto mother, in the north-central Cuban town of Sagua la Grande. His father was a shopkeeper, respected among the Chinese in the community as an educated man who spoke several
